Shipping temperature-sensitive medicines necessitates qualified cold-chain containers, Appropriate refrigerants, and maintained temperature monitoring. Specify an express service where possible, Pre-condition gel packs, and Add a data logger in the carton to verify that medical drugs stayed within their labeled temperature range.
Fragile glass vials of Medicines must be packed in cell dividers with surrounding foam. Place trays inside a sturdy shipping box and stabilize using void-fill so nothing moves. For moisture-sensitive medical drugs, Combine this with moisture-barrier inner bags and desiccants.
International shipments of Pharmaceutical goods typically demand a detailed commercial invoice, packing list, and any authorizations required by the importing country. Several markets also Expect Certificates of Analysis, proof of GDP-compliant handling, and clear temperature instructions for cold-chain medicines. Verify requirements with your customs broker before shipping.
For moisture-sensitive Medicines, select moisture-proof inner liners plus desiccant sachets inside the packaging. Close cartons tightly, avoid damaged boxes, and Choose transport options that minimize exposure to rain and high humidity, such as covered docks and climate-controlled linehaul for medical drugs.
High-value Pharma products generally need tailored cargo insurance that covers temperature excursions, breakage, and theft. Coordinate with an insurer familiar with pharmaceutical goods, Declare the full replacement value, and store temperature and handling records so claims can be processed efficiently if something goes wrong.
Pharmaceuticals require temperature-controlled environments during ocean transport to ensure product integrity. Proper insulation and refrigeration methods must be employed, particularly for temperature-sensitive medications. Additionally, securing the cargo to prevent movement during transit is crucial to avoid damage.
Pharmaceuticals exported from Australia to the United States must comply with both Australian export regulations and U.S. import regulations, including FDA requirements. This includes obtaining necessary permits, ensuring labeling compliance, and providing documentation such as a Certificate of Analysis and an import permit from the FDA for controlled substances.
